DavidP.Nov 12, 20029I know writers, alcoholics mothers, women and the south; this movie is not a fantasy. It is largely based on Larry Brown's story "92 Days" (which I believe he dedicated to "Buk", Charles Bukowski, another alcoholic writer). And regardless of what the critics may say, I loved this movie and highly reciommend it!
